A Surveillance report By Schiff reveals that the Ministry of Health and Social Services also plans to present outside political banners. The Trump administration has reward A contract for two “Make America Healthy Again Building Banners” at the HHS headquarters, which are not yet revealed. By Contractual documentsThe signs must measure 11 feet to 88 feet and be made to last “preferably” the length of Trump’s term. Although they present “different illustrations”, the images are not detailed in the report, but if history is an indication, one of them can represent the scowl.

Between the three banner orders reported, the Trump administration consumed about $ 56,000 in taxpayers. USDA banners cost $ 16,400, $ 33,726 HHS banners and the banners of the Labor Department around $ 6,000 – although Schiff notes, the total cost is “still to be determined”.

According to Schiff, banners could submit to federal laws of credits which prohibit funding spending for “advertising or propaganda”. Be that as it may, as the senator notes, they serve as a “austere visual demonstration of the measures that President Trump and his administration consolidate the power and the control which are antithetical to American democracy”.
